shows that in this example the fourth (that is, residual) input channel of the preprocessing block
is not connected in SMT tool. Thus the preprocessing block will automatically calculate 3Uo
inside by vectorial sum from the three phase to earth voltages connected to the first three input
channels of the same preprocessing block. Alternatively, the fourth input channel can be
connected to open delta VT input, as shown in Figure 23.
is a Preprocessing block that has the task to digitally filter the connected analog inputs and
calculate:
fundamental frequency phasors for all input channels
harmonic content for all input channels
positive, negative and zero sequence quantities by using the fundamental frequency
phasors for the first three input channels (channel one taken as reference for sequence
quantities)
These calculated values are then available for all built-in protection and control functions within
the IED, which are connected to this preprocessing function block in the configuration tool. For
this application most of the preprocessing settings can be left to the default values. However the
following settings shall be set as shown here:
UBase=66 kV (that is, rated Ph-Ph voltage)
